*Contributions will be taken via the same method as your main plan contributions either by NICE Pensions (salary sacrifice) or the traditional payroll deduction method (net pay), if you have asked for this or if your pay does not meet the minimum requirement for NICE Pensions. There is more information on this on the Plan website, Please note that NICE Pensions is referred to as 'Simple salary sacrifice' on the salary sacrifice calculator.
If you pay contributions by NICE Pensions (salary sacrifice), you confirm that you understand that this will change the amount of your pension payment and is therefore a change to your terms and conditions of employment. You can read more about NICE Pensions on the Plan website.
If you would like to change how you contribute your AVCs from NICE Pensions to the traditional payroll deduction method, please complete the Change how I pay my contributions form.
It is your responsibility to check that by making AVCs, this doesn't take you over the annual allowance limit. Details can be found in the Pension Tax Rules factsheet.
If you have an existing AVC account, the investments related to that will apply to these future AVC’s. If you don’t have an existing AVC account, a new account will be created with the default investment option, the Lifetime Advantage Fund.
